Output 366f8c2399fa71be8d9977e23102854567aba2d9e92a3acb51fbc40f40d1c380:56

value
3486896
script pubkey
OP_0 OP_PUSHBYTES_20 489ec4270844ab1458a9f2194440a470d6915d74
address
bc1qfz0vgfcggj43gk9f7gv5gs9ywrtfzht5rhytru
transaction
366f8c2399fa71be8d9977e23102854567aba2d9e92a3acb51fbc40f40d1c380
spent
true